Circulation DeskWhen people think of libraries, loaning books is the most visible and well-known service. Thus, the Circulation Desk is the hub of energy on the first floor.
Many library users place holds online, and regularly visit the library only to pick up their holds at the Circulation Desk. Much of the face-to-face interaction between staff and patrons takes place at this desk. Our team knows peoples’ names and enjoys chatting with children. IMPACT
